§ 7. Binding Provisions. Notwithstanding any other provision of this LOI, the Parties acknowledge and agree that § 7 (Binding Provisions), § 8 (Confidentiality), § 9 (Exclusivity), § 10 (Expenses), and § 12 (Governing Law; Venue) are intended to be, and shall constitute, legally binding and enforceable obligations of the Parties. All other provisions of this LOI are non-binding statements of present intent only.

§ 9. Exclusivity. For a period of ________ following the date of acceptance of this LOI, the Parties agree to negotiate the Definitive Agreement exclusively and in good faith with one another, and shall not solicit, initiate, or entertain any competing proposal with respect to the goods that are the subject of the Prospective Transaction.

§ 10. Expenses. Each Party shall bear its own costs and expenses, including legal and advisory fees, incurred in connection with the negotiation and preparation of this LOI and the Definitive Agreement, whether or not the Prospective Transaction is consummated.

§ 11. No Reliance; No Obligation to Proceed. Each Party acknowledges that, except for the binding provisions identified in § 7, neither Party is relying upon any statement, representation, or course of conduct of the other in connection with this LOI, and that either Party may, in its sole discretion and for any reason or no reason, terminate negotiations at any time prior to the execution of a Definitive Agreement, without liability to the other Party.

§ 12. Governing Law; Venue. This LOI, and the binding provisions hereof, shall be governed by and construed in accordance with the laws of the State of ________, including its Uniform Commercial Code, without regard to its conflict-of-laws principles. The Parties consent to the exclusive jurisdiction and venue of the state and federal courts located in ________ for any dispute arising out of or relating to the binding provisions of this LOI.
